The article presents views of a visitor of the Siberian science center Akademgorodok in Novosibirsk, Russia. The first impression of the center, including the physical plant and its natural environment, is that here is an ideal realized. Akademgorodok was almost a technological nightmare instead of a humanistic showplace. The original plans called for the erection of those huge skyscrapers. Nature was to have been locked out, men would have been locked in, and minds would surely have been sterilized by artificiality.
